An urn contains 3 red and 5 orange marbles. 2 marbles are selected without replacement. Find the probability that the second mar
Afina-wow [57]

Answer: \dfrac{5}{14}

Step-by-step explanation:

Given: An urn contains 3 red and 5 orange marbles.

Total marbles = 3+5=8

Probability of getting orange marble = \dfrac{\text{Number of orange marble}}{\text{Total}}

=\dfrac{5}{8}

Now marbles left = 7

Orange marbles left = 4

and Probability of getting orange marble = \dfrac47

The probability that the second marble selected is orange given that the first marble selected is orange=\dfrac58\times\dfrac47=\dfrac{5}{2}\times\dfrac17=\dfrac{5}{14}

Required probability= \dfrac{5}{14}

Mateo has 7/2 pounds of apples. He needs 3/4 pounds of apples for each batch of applesauce. How many batches of applesauce can
Annette [7]

Answer:

4

Step-by-step explanation:

Given that:

Total pounds of apple = 7/2 pounds

Pounds of apple needed per batch of applesauce = 3/4 pounds

Number of batches of applesauce which can be made :

Total pounds of apple / pounds of apple needed per batch

7/2 ÷ 3/4

7/2 * 4/3

= 28/6

= 4 4/6

= 4 2/3

Hence, number of batches of applesauce which can be made is 4
